2023-2024 Season: August 19, 2023-May 24, 2024

Stretch & Strength on Tuesdays from 6:15-7:00pm

Drawing from  yoga, ballet and Pilates, we will work on your core strength, while also working on deep breathing and deep stretching to increase your energy and flexibility.  We will be using light ankle weights- 5lbs total, a foam roller, yoga matt and  2 lacrosse balls ( for myofacial release to decrease pain and increase flexibility). Please purchase these items, label them with your name, and bring them to all classes, as we will not be able to share items.

Tap on Tuesdays from 7:15-8:15pm

This class is geared towards tap beginners and those who haven’t tapped in a while. We will learn tap technique, history, classic and modern choreography, and fun combinations that will keep you dancing all week long. Relaxed workout attire and tap shoes required.

Yoga on Wednesdays from 9:30-10:15am

A Vinyasa-style class that focuses on integrating breath with movement. We practice the foundations of yoga asana (poses) to strengthen and nurture our bodies and minds. This class offers personalized sequences to meet those who attend, aiming to provide an accessible and sustainable movement practice.

Ballet Barre on Wednesdays from 7:00-8:00pm

This class is designed to fine tune adult students' ballet vocabulary and muscle memory with focused work at the barre. Students can expect to increase strength and flexibility while following the traditional sequence of a classical ballet class without the worry of being asked to pirouette in the center.

Ballet Basics 1 on Saturdays from 10:15-11:45am

Students with little or no experience are welcome. Class begins with exercises at the barre and progresses to combinations in the center of the room. 

Ballet Basics 2 on Saturdays from 11:45am-1:15pm 

Students should have at least one year of ballet experience and a basic knowledge of ballet vocabulary. Many students are returning to ballet after several (or more) years. Class begins with exercises at the barre and progresses to centerwork.
